Home
last modified time | relevance | path

Searched refs:src_a (Results 1 – 25 of 40) sorted by relevance

12

/external/libyuv/files/unit_test/
Dcompare_test.cc36 align_buffer_page_end(src_a, kMaxTest); in TEST_F()
48 src_a[i] = (fastrand() & 0xff); in TEST_F()
52 uint32 h1 = HashDjb2(src_a, kMaxTest, 5381); in TEST_F()
57 memcpy(src_a + kMaxTest / 2, src_b + kMaxTest / 2, kMaxTest / 2); in TEST_F()
58 h1 = HashDjb2(src_a, kMaxTest, 5381); in TEST_F()
63 memcpy(src_a + kMaxTest / 2, src_a, kMaxTest / 2); in TEST_F()
65 memcpy(src_a, src_b, kMaxTest / 2); in TEST_F()
66 h1 = HashDjb2(src_a, kMaxTest, 5381); in TEST_F()
71 memcpy(src_a, src_b, kMaxTest); in TEST_F()
72 h1 = HashDjb2(src_a, kMaxTest, 5381); in TEST_F()
[all …]
/external/libyuv/files/source/
Dcompare.cc115 uint64 ComputeSumSquareError(const uint8* src_a, in ComputeSumSquareError() argument
125 uint32 (*SumSquareError)(const uint8* src_a, const uint8* src_b, int count) = in ComputeSumSquareError()
148 sse += SumSquareError(src_a + i, src_b + i, kBlockSize); in ComputeSumSquareError()
150 src_a += count & ~(kBlockSize - 1); in ComputeSumSquareError()
153 sse += SumSquareError(src_a, src_b, remainder); in ComputeSumSquareError()
154 src_a += remainder; in ComputeSumSquareError()
159 sse += SumSquareError_C(src_a, src_b, remainder); in ComputeSumSquareError()
165 uint64 ComputeSumSquareErrorPlane(const uint8* src_a, in ComputeSumSquareErrorPlane() argument
180 sse += ComputeSumSquareError(src_a, src_b, width); in ComputeSumSquareErrorPlane()
181 src_a += stride_a; in ComputeSumSquareErrorPlane()
[all …]
Dcompare_neon64.cc23 uint32 SumSquareError_NEON(const uint8* src_a, const uint8* src_b, int count) { in SumSquareError_NEON() argument
50 : "+r"(src_a), in SumSquareError_NEON()
Dcompare_neon.cc24 uint32 SumSquareError_NEON(const uint8* src_a, const uint8* src_b, int count) { in SumSquareError_NEON() argument
52 : "+r"(src_a), in SumSquareError_NEON()
Dcompare_common.cc20 uint32 SumSquareError_C(const uint8* src_a, const uint8* src_b, int count) { in SumSquareError_C() argument
24 int diff = src_a[i] - src_b[i]; in SumSquareError_C()
Dcompare_gcc.cc25 uint32 SumSquareError_SSE2(const uint8* src_a, const uint8* src_b, int count) { in SumSquareError_SSE2() argument
56 : "+r"(src_a), // %0 in SumSquareError_SSE2()
Dconvert_argb.cc575 const uint8* src_a, in I420AlphaToARGBMatrix() argument
675 I422AlphaToARGBRow(src_y, src_u, src_v, src_a, dst_argb, yuvconstants, in I420AlphaToARGBMatrix()
681 src_a += src_stride_a; in I420AlphaToARGBMatrix()
699 const uint8* src_a, in I420AlphaToARGB() argument
707 src_stride_v, src_a, src_stride_a, dst_argb, in I420AlphaToARGB()
720 const uint8* src_a, in I420AlphaToABGR() argument
729 src_u, src_stride_u, src_a, src_stride_a, dst_abgr, dst_stride_abgr, in I420AlphaToABGR()
Dcompare_win.cc25 SumSquareError_SSE2(const uint8* src_a, const uint8* src_b, int count) { in SumSquareError_SSE2() argument
66 SumSquareError_AVX2(const uint8* src_a, const uint8* src_b, int count) { in SumSquareError_AVX2() argument
/external/libvpx/libvpx/third_party/libyuv/source/
Dcompare.cc116 uint64 ComputeSumSquareError(const uint8* src_a, const uint8* src_b, in ComputeSumSquareError() argument
125 uint32 (*SumSquareError)(const uint8* src_a, const uint8* src_b, int count) = in ComputeSumSquareError()
148 sse += SumSquareError(src_a + i, src_b + i, kBlockSize); in ComputeSumSquareError()
150 src_a += count & ~(kBlockSize - 1); in ComputeSumSquareError()
153 sse += SumSquareError(src_a, src_b, remainder); in ComputeSumSquareError()
154 src_a += remainder; in ComputeSumSquareError()
159 sse += SumSquareError_C(src_a, src_b, remainder); in ComputeSumSquareError()
165 uint64 ComputeSumSquareErrorPlane(const uint8* src_a, int stride_a, in ComputeSumSquareErrorPlane() argument
178 sse += ComputeSumSquareError(src_a, src_b, width); in ComputeSumSquareErrorPlane()
179 src_a += stride_a; in ComputeSumSquareErrorPlane()
[all …]
Dcompare_neon64.cc23 uint32 SumSquareError_NEON(const uint8* src_a, const uint8* src_b, int count) { in SumSquareError_NEON() argument
50 : "+r"(src_a), in SumSquareError_NEON()
Dcompare_neon.cc24 uint32 SumSquareError_NEON(const uint8* src_a, const uint8* src_b, int count) { in SumSquareError_NEON() argument
52 : "+r"(src_a), in SumSquareError_NEON()
Dcompare_common.cc20 uint32 SumSquareError_C(const uint8* src_a, const uint8* src_b, int count) { in SumSquareError_C() argument
24 int diff = src_a[i] - src_b[i]; in SumSquareError_C()
Dcompare_gcc.cc25 uint32 SumSquareError_SSE2(const uint8* src_a, const uint8* src_b, int count) { in SumSquareError_SSE2() argument
56 : "+r"(src_a), // %0 in SumSquareError_SSE2()
Dconvert_argb.cc563 const uint8* src_a, int src_stride_a, in I420AlphaToARGBMatrix() argument
646 I422AlphaToARGBRow(src_y, src_u, src_v, src_a, dst_argb, yuvconstants, in I420AlphaToARGBMatrix()
652 src_a += src_stride_a; in I420AlphaToARGBMatrix()
667 const uint8* src_a, int src_stride_a, in I420AlphaToARGB() argument
673 src_a, src_stride_a, in I420AlphaToARGB()
684 const uint8* src_a, int src_stride_a, in I420AlphaToABGR() argument
690 src_a, src_stride_a, in I420AlphaToABGR()
Dcompare_win.cc25 uint32 SumSquareError_SSE2(const uint8* src_a, const uint8* src_b, int count) { in SumSquareError_SSE2() argument
66 uint32 SumSquareError_AVX2(const uint8* src_a, const uint8* src_b, int count) { in SumSquareError_AVX2() argument
/external/libyuv/files/util/
Dpsnr.cc41 static uint32 SumSquareError_NEON(const uint8* src_a, in SumSquareError_NEON() argument
69 : "+r"(src_a), "+r"(src_b), "+r"(count), "=r"(sse) in SumSquareError_NEON()
76 static uint32 SumSquareError_NEON(const uint8* src_a, in SumSquareError_NEON() argument
103 : "+r"(src_a), "+r"(src_b), "+r"(count), "=r"(sse) in SumSquareError_NEON()
149 static uint32 SumSquareError_SSE2(const uint8* src_a, in SumSquareError_SSE2() argument
182 : "+r"(src_a), // %0 in SumSquareError_SSE2()
231 static uint32 SumSquareError_C(const uint8* src_a, in SumSquareError_C() argument
236 int diff = src_a[x] - src_b[x]; in SumSquareError_C()
242 double ComputeSumSquareError(const uint8* src_a, in ComputeSumSquareError() argument
245 uint32 (*SumSquareError)(const uint8* src_a, const uint8* src_b, int count) = in ComputeSumSquareError()
[all …]
/external/webp/src/demux/
Danim_decode.c197 static uint8_t BlendChannelNonPremult(uint32_t src, uint8_t src_a, in BlendChannelNonPremult() argument
202 const uint32_t blend_unscaled = src_channel * src_a + dst_channel * dst_a; in BlendChannelNonPremult()
209 const uint8_t src_a = (src >> 24) & 0xff; in BlendPixelNonPremult() local
211 if (src_a == 0) { in BlendPixelNonPremult()
217 const uint8_t dst_factor_a = (dst_a * (256 - src_a)) >> 8; in BlendPixelNonPremult()
218 const uint8_t blend_a = src_a + dst_factor_a; in BlendPixelNonPremult()
222 BlendChannelNonPremult(src, src_a, dst, dst_factor_a, scale, 0); in BlendPixelNonPremult()
224 BlendChannelNonPremult(src, src_a, dst, dst_factor_a, scale, 8); in BlendPixelNonPremult()
226 BlendChannelNonPremult(src, src_a, dst, dst_factor_a, scale, 16); in BlendPixelNonPremult()
227 assert(src_a + dst_factor_a < 256); in BlendPixelNonPremult()
[all …]
/external/libyuv/files/include/libyuv/
Dcompare_row.h70 uint32 SumSquareError_C(const uint8* src_a, const uint8* src_b, int count);
71 uint32 SumSquareError_SSE2(const uint8* src_a, const uint8* src_b, int count);
72 uint32 SumSquareError_AVX2(const uint8* src_a, const uint8* src_b, int count);
73 uint32 SumSquareError_NEON(const uint8* src_a, const uint8* src_b, int count);
Dcompare.h32 uint64 ComputeSumSquareError(const uint8* src_a, const uint8* src_b, int count);
35 uint64 ComputeSumSquareErrorPlane(const uint8* src_a,
48 double CalcFramePsnr(const uint8* src_a,
72 double CalcFrameSsim(const uint8* src_a,
/external/libvpx/libvpx/third_party/libyuv/include/libyuv/
Dcompare.h32 uint64 ComputeSumSquareError(const uint8* src_a,
36 uint64 ComputeSumSquareErrorPlane(const uint8* src_a, int stride_a,
46 double CalcFramePsnr(const uint8* src_a, int stride_a,
60 double CalcFrameSsim(const uint8* src_a, int stride_a,
Dconvert_argb.h98 const uint8* src_a, int src_stride_a,
107 const uint8* src_a, int src_stride_a,
/external/mesa3d/src/gallium/drivers/vc4/
Dvc4_nir_lower_blend.c181 nir_ssa_def *src_a, in vc4_blend_channel_i() argument
192 return src_a; in vc4_blend_channel_i()
200 src_a, in vc4_blend_channel_i()
213 return nir_inot(b, src_a); in vc4_blend_channel_i()
343 nir_ssa_def *src_a = nir_pack_unorm_4x8(b, src_float_a); in vc4_do_blending_i() local
360 src_a, dst_a, in vc4_do_blending_i()
365 src_a, dst_a, in vc4_do_blending_i()
374 src_a, dst_a, in vc4_do_blending_i()
386 src_a, dst_a, in vc4_do_blending_i()
/external/deqp/external/openglcts/modules/glesext/draw_buffers_indexed/
DesextcDrawBuffersIndexedBase.cpp256 glw::GLenum dst_rgb, glw::GLenum src_a, in SetBlendFuncSeparatei() argument
259 gl.blendFuncSeparatei(idx, src_rgb, dst_rgb, src_a, dst_a); in SetBlendFuncSeparatei()
261 state[idx].func_src_a = src_a; in SetBlendFuncSeparatei()
336 glw::GLenum src_a, glw::GLenum dst_a) in SetBlendFuncSeparate() argument
339 gl.blendFuncSeparate(src_rgb, dst_rgb, src_a, dst_a); in SetBlendFuncSeparate()
343 state[i].func_src_a = src_a; in SetBlendFuncSeparate()
DesextcDrawBuffersIndexedBase.hpp105 void SetBlendFuncSeparatei(int idx, glw::GLenum src_rgb, glw::GLenum dst_rgb, glw::GLenum src_a,
113 …void SetBlendFuncSeparate(glw::GLenum src_rgb, glw::GLenum dst_rgb, glw::GLenum src_a, glw::GLenum…
/external/libvpx/libvpx/vpx_dsp/x86/
Dvariance_avx2.c292 const __m256i src_a = _mm256_loadu_si256((__m256i const *)src); in spv32_x4_y4() local
294 __m256i prev_src_avg = _mm256_avg_epu8(src_a, src_b); in spv32_x4_y4()
384 const __m256i src_a = _mm256_loadu_si256((__m256i const *)src); in spv32_x4_yb() local
386 __m256i prev_src_avg = _mm256_avg_epu8(src_a, src_b); in spv32_x4_yb()
423 const __m256i src_a = _mm256_loadu_si256((__m256i const *)src); in spv32_xb_y4() local
428 exp_src_lo = _mm256_unpacklo_epi8(src_a, src_b); in spv32_xb_y4()
429 exp_src_hi = _mm256_unpackhi_epi8(src_a, src_b); in spv32_xb_y4()
476 const __m256i src_a = _mm256_loadu_si256((__m256i const *)src); in spv32_xb_yb() local
481 exp_src_lo = _mm256_unpacklo_epi8(src_a, src_b); in spv32_xb_yb()
482 exp_src_hi = _mm256_unpackhi_epi8(src_a, src_b); in spv32_xb_yb()

12